Holden and I stopped in our tracks and before I had a chance to stop him, Holden closed the distance between him and Logan, slamming him into the locker. "What are you trying to do!?" He exclaimed.
"You think I wanted my family name smeared across the front cover of every paper in the country!?" Logan shifted his weight and shoved Holden backwards.
"Guys stop!" I yelled. Before I had a chance to step in, they were back at it. Holden had Logan by the lapels of his blazer up against the locker.
"Take this somewhere else! You want everyone here to see this!?" Parker's voice came from behind me. He grabbed Holden by his arms and pulled him backwards. "You okay?" He asked, looking at me. I nodded.
"Calm down man. We can fix this," Parker said to Holden. "Let's talk about this somewhere more private."
"Are you okay?" I asked, turning to Logan.
"Fine," he said gruffly, straightening his blazer.
The four of us were standing around in their club room. Parker made sure to stand in between Logan and Holden. "The DNA you ran...is it mine?" Holden asked.
Advertisement
Logan crossed his arms and leaned against the table of the kitchenette. "Yeah," he said.
"You're fucking lying. What are you getting out of this?" Holden snapped. Logan rolled his eyes.
"And why the fuck would I want to do that?"
"I don't know. You're the psycho with some vendetta against me!"
"Daisy?" Logan looked at me and I knew it was finally time to talk about what I'd heard at the gala that night. I'd been pretending that I hadn't heard anything. I'd told myself it was to 'protect' Logan and Holden, but I'd just been too cowardly to do anything about it.
"You knew?" Holden asked.
"This isn't her fault, Holden," Parker said slowly.
"I'm sorry!" I exclaimed.
"Tell him," Logan said. "Please...you promised that when I was ready to hear it, you'd tell me."
"When did you become best friends?" Holden continued. "Did you forget this guy got someone to steal your uniform and blackmailed us?"
"I'm so sorry Holden." The lump in my throat was growing and my heart was about to break free from my ribcage.
"You're trying to tell me that this DNA test isn't a complete fraud? How is this even possible?"
"You think this is just a problem for you? At least both of your parents are your parents!" Logan yelled.
"Daisy...I just need to know if what he's saying is true," Holden said.
"It is," I whispered. The colour drained from his face, a blank expression replacing the anger in his eyes. "Holden," I said, holding onto his forearm. He pulled away from me.
"Don't touch me." Then he left the room, slamming the door behind him.
"Can we talk?" Logan asked.
"I'll leave. Just lock the room up when you leave," Parker said, giving me a key.
"Thanks Parker." He nodded.
Logan sat down at a stool by the kitchenette, his head in his hands. "God this is a huge mess," he said. I sat down beside him. When I found out he hadn't opened the results of the DNA test, I thought this wouldn't ever surface. I should've known a secret this big couldn't stay a secret. "Will you tell me what you heard that night now?"
Advertisement
So I told him everything. How his parents had a big fight while they were engaged. How his mum had been drunk that night and slept with Holden's dad, who at the time was not in any relationship. How she hadn't slept with Logan's father until How she'd kept it a secret until Logan had ordered the DNA test.
"She said she loved you. All of you," I said. "She was crying because she was scared she was going to lose you."
"I should never have done it. If I hadn't ordered that test, none of this ever would have happened." The tears fell down his cheeks and he rubbed them away with his sleeve.
"You're going to be okay," I said, even though I wasn't sure it'd be true. Would any of their lives be the same after this? He turned to me, his head fell against my shoulder, and instinctively, I wrapped my arms around him. I could feel the warmth of his tears seep through onto my shoulder.
--
Holden hadn't made it to any of our classes and I didn't know where he'd gone. He'd ignored all the messages I'd sent him. Final class ended and I texted Parker as soon as the bell went off.
D: How's Holden?
P: I'll call you
Before I had a chance to protest, my phone started ringing. "Hello?" I answered.
"Holden's holed himself up at home. I'll pick you up outside the gate." His voice was ragged like he'd been running.
I hurried out to the parking lot where I found Parker's car. I got into the passenger seat, but Parker was still leaning over his steering wheel, staring out into the yard. "Who are we waiting for?" I asked.
"Allie," he said. "She's probably the only one who's ever seen Holden like this. Maybe she can calm him down."
A few minutes later I saw Allie hurrying out towards the car. "Sorry guys, maths teacher was way too excited to talk about logarithms," she said, slinging her bag into the bag seat and crawling in afterwards. "Did he barricade himself in his room again?" She asked.
Parker nodded. "I think so."
"He always does this," Allie groaned. "Likes to run from his problems."
"The last time this happened -" Parker began, but he glanced over at me and stopped. There was history between all of them long before I met them. I'd always felt like there was something unfinished between Holden and Allie.
"It's okay, you don't have to fill me in," I said.
"It's all in the past, and I've moved on from it," Allie said. She took in a deep breath. "The reason me and Holden broke up was because I got pregnant, and I miscarried before we had a chance to talk about what we were going to do. It was just too much for us to get past."
"I'm so sorry," I said.
She shrugged. "My parents were pissed. Only the three of us knew - and now four of us do," she smiled sadly at me. "When we broke up, Holden really went off the rails for a while. We were just kids though, there was no way we'd be able to keep the baby. But it was just too much to handle." She looked up for a moment and she stifled a sniffle.
"A part of me will always love Holden, and there'll always be something tying us together. So I don't want to see him go down that road again."
